Transaction 698c26af4eb5fc29feec84312768eda656cd781623f6034c61eb9de8bfe9300e
1 Input
1 Output
-
698c26af4eb5fc29feec84312768eda656cd781623f6034c61eb9de8bfe9300e:0
- value
- 1612115
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 658d491a5c732f20a518eefd6773067a146ae73c OP_EQUAL
- address
- 3AwyRcQm86qz3QWVTvTzjpQV859cGbzE3J